返回顶部

收藏

DataGrid之间拖拽与复制

更多
<?xml version=\"1.0\" encoding=\"utf-8\"?>
<mx:Application xmlns:mx=\"http://www.adobe.com/2006/mxml\"
        layout=\"horizontal\"
        verticalAlign=\"middle\"
        backgroundColor=\"white\" viewSourceURL=\"srcview/index.html\">

    <mx:Array id=\"arr\">
        <mx:Object colA=\"Item A.0\" colB=\"Item B.0\" colC=\"Item C.0\" />
        <mx:Object colA=\"Item A.1\" colB=\"Item B.1\" colC=\"Item C.1\" />
        <mx:Object colA=\"Item A.2\" colB=\"Item B.2\" colC=\"Item C.2\" />
        <mx:Object colA=\"Item A.3\" colB=\"Item B.3\" colC=\"Item C.3\" />
        <mx:Object colA=\"Item A.4\" colB=\"Item B.4\" colC=\"Item C.4\" />
        <mx:Object colA=\"Item A.5\" colB=\"Item B.5\" colC=\"Item C.5\" />
        <mx:Object colA=\"Item A.6\" colB=\"Item B.6\" colC=\"Item C.6\" />
        <mx:Object colA=\"Item A.7\" colB=\"Item B.7\" colC=\"Item C.7\" />
        <mx:Object colA=\"Item A.8\" colB=\"Item B.8\" colC=\"Item C.8\" />
        <mx:Object colA=\"Item A.9\" colB=\"Item B.9\" colC=\"Item C.9\" />
    </mx:Array>

    <mx:ApplicationControlBar dock=\"true\">
        <mx:Form>
            <mx:FormItem label=\"DataGrid #1:\"
                    direction=\"horizontal\">
                <mx:CheckBox id=\"dg1_dragEnabled\"
                        label=\"dragEnabled\" />
                <mx:CheckBox id=\"dg1_dropEnabled\"
                        label=\"dropEnabled\" />
                <mx:CheckBox id=\"dg1_dragMoveEnabled\"
                        label=\"dragMoveEnabled\" />
            </mx:FormItem>
            <mx:FormItem label=\"DataGrid #2:\"
                    direction=\"horizontal\">
                <mx:CheckBox id=\"dg2_dragEnabled\"
                        label=\"dragEnabled\" />
                <mx:CheckBox id=\"dg2_dropEnabled\"
                        label=\"dropEnabled\" />
                <mx:CheckBox id=\"dg2_dragMoveEnabled\"
                        label=\"dragMoveEnabled\" />
            </mx:FormItem>
        </mx:Form>
    </mx:ApplicationControlBar>

    <mx:VBox width=\"50%\">
        <mx:Label text=\"DataGrid #1\" />
        <mx:DataGrid id=\"dataGrid1\"
                width=\"100%\"
                rowHeight=\"22\"
                dataProvider=\"{arr}\"
                dragEnabled=\"{dg1_dragEnabled.selected}\"
                dragMoveEnabled=\"{dg1_dragMoveEnabled.selected}\"
                dropEnabled=\"{dg1_dropEnabled.selected}\"
                verticalScrollPolicy=\"on\">
            <mx:columns>
                <mx:DataGridColumn dataField=\"colA\"
                        headerText=\"Column A\" />
                <mx:DataGridColumn dataField=\"colB\"
                        headerText=\"Column B\" />
                <mx:DataGridColumn dataField=\"colC\"
                        headerText=\"Column C\" />
            </mx:columns>
        </mx:DataGrid>
        <mx:Label text=\"{dataGrid1.dataProvider.length} items\" />
    </mx:VBox>

    <mx:VBox width=\"50%\">
        <mx:Label text=\"DataGrid #2\" />
        <mx:DataGrid id=\"dataGrid2\"
                width=\"100%\"
                rowHeight=\"22\"
                dataProvider=\"[]\"
                dragEnabled=\"{dg2_dragEnabled.selected}\"
                dragMoveEnabled=\"{dg2_dragMoveEnabled.selected}\"
                dropEnabled=\"{dg2_dropEnabled.selected}\"
                verticalScrollPolicy=\"on\">
            <mx:columns>
                <mx:DataGridColumn dataField=\"colA\"
                        headerText=\"Column A\" />
                <mx:DataGridColumn dataField=\"colB\"
                        headerText=\"Column B\" />
                <mx:DataGridColumn dataField=\"colC\"
                        headerText=\"Column C\" />
            </mx:columns>
        </mx:DataGrid>
        <mx:Label text=\"{dataGrid2.dataProvider.length} items\" />
    </mx:VBox>

</mx:Application>
//该片段来自于http://outofmemory.cn

标签:flash,ActionScript,控件

收藏

0人收藏

支持

0

反对

0

相关聚客文章
  1. powerfj 发表 2013-09-12 23:27:15 Flash As3与JS参数传递的时候的两个bug
  2. dansion 发表 2009-10-19 20:46:40 FLASH Loader 的 bug?
  3. viviworld 发表 2016-03-10 14:00:27 产品设计师的前世今生
  4. 朴人博客 发表 2012-12-15 05:11:35 初识新版FusionCharts(3.2)系列flash图表控件
  5. 罗杰 发表 2013-03-16 08:02:19 浅谈 Cookies与Flash Cookies 跟踪防护技巧
  6. 独孤逸辰 发表 2011-11-08 16:16:53 firefox下reflow导致flash重新加载的解决方法
  7. 博主 发表 2010-11-22 16:00:00 无限级联动控件的设计
  8. qiqi 发表 2013-07-06 01:03:26 很神秘的紫色咖啡网站
  9. jiazhoulvke 发表 2013-08-13 01:32:05 Fuck Adobe!
  10. 朴人博客 发表 2013-10-30 17:24:50 使用Flash AIR创建桌面无提示拍照应用示例
  11. 天外飞仙 发表 2014-04-07 05:00:14 jquery模拟flash动画按钮特效
  12. 博主 发表 2012-02-27 17:06:00 Flash冒烟程序

发表评论